Kinds of Welder’s Certifications

Although the American Welding Society’s standard Certified Welder certificate helps make you eligible for almost all jobs, specific fields call for their specialized certification. A handful of the most-widely used of which are highlighted below.

  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for those that work on pipelines in the gas and oil field
  • ASME Certification for those that focus on boiler and pressure containers
  • CWI and SCWI Certification for inspectors and senior inspectors
  •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der

Information Covered in Welding Specialist Training in Skandia, MI

Despite the fact that there is not a book on the ways to pick the right welding schools, there are specific points to consider. You could possibly be told that brazing courses are all exactly the same, but there are some areas you really should be aware of before deciding on which welding specialist schools to sign up for in Skandia, MI. While you might have already decided upon which program or school to enroll in, you really should check if the welding specialist program holds the necessary qualifications with the AWS. When you finish looking into the accreditation situation, you should also research a little deeper to be certain that the school you are considering can supply you with the best training.

  • Attempt to find courses that comply with AWS SENSE standards
  • Make certain the school teaches with tools that matches present industry requirements
  • See if the college gives financial aid
  • Make sure that the school’s curriculum provides courses in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
